Woman claims Publix cashier threw away winning lotto ticket
A continuation ticket is a ticket which is issued when a person purchases a ticket for several draws in advance, and wins a prize before the entire draw range is completed, the lottery machine issues a ticket for the remainder of the time the ticket is valid.
